4R2H
The Crystal Structure of B204, the DNA-packaging ATPase from Sulfolobus Turreted Icosahedral Virus
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 8 | 298 | 1.5M ammonium phosphate dibasic, 0.1M TRIS-HCl pH 8.0,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
Crystal Properties | |
---|---|
Matthews coefficient | Solvent content |
2.1 | 41.39 |
